I picked up my PIE switch from Crutchfield
http://www.crutchfield.com/S-JaoR08F...e&i=469FRD4AUX
I also have a Sirius unit in my Mustang, so I also have a Crytal-Line toggle. This creates two AUX outputs and has a very cleanly mounted switch that is flush mounted into the console around the head unit. It truly looks like it belongs there.
With this setup, it is a rare circumstance that causes me to fire up the Skipper 500.
